Product Description:
The MHD112B-058-PG0-BN is a servo motor manufactured by Bosch Rexroth Indramat as part of the MHD Synchronous Motors series. Designed for closed-loop motion tasks, the unit converts electrical energy into precisely regulated mechanical rotation that drives tooling heads, gantry axes, and integrated handling modules in industrial automation cells. Its construction supports high duty cycles and electronic coordination with digital drives, making it a core actuator wherever repeatable speed and torque curves are required. The motor is intended for applications that need accurate starts, stops, and speed changes under varying load conditions. This makes it suitable for packaging, material-handling, and machine-tool subsystems that depend on synchronized axis motion.
The motor has a centering diameter of 130 mm, allowing the flange to seat accurately on gearboxes or machine frames. Under continuous stall conditions, the stator can deliver 28.0 Nm without exceeding thermal limits, supplying steady force for holding or low-speed feed motions. The square flange measures 192 mm, providing a standardized mounting face for compatible mechanical interfaces. Heat generated in the windings is removed through liquid cooling, so output can be sustained even in tightly sealed cabinets. Electrical power reaches the stator through a connector on side B, which can simplify cable routing when the rear of the motor faces the cabinet wall. This mounting and cooling arrangement helps maintain alignment and stable thermal behavior during long production runs.
Feedback and internal sensing use digital servo feedback with an integrated encoder, transmitting absolute position data across >4096 revolutions for fine closed-loop control without homing cycles. The rotor uses a plain shaft, so couplings or pulleys can slide on without keyways when zero-backlash connections are preferred. Electromagnetic behavior is set by winding code 058, aligning resistance and inductance with compatible drive amplifiers for fast current response. Because the encoder is integrated, the drive can monitor rotor position continuously during acceleration, deceleration, and standstill. An internal shaft seal helps limit the entry of coolant splash and dust at the shaft area. The shaft style is also well suited to clamp couplings and other hub connections used on precision axes.
